Post by Foggy » Thu Feb 26, 2015 5:20 pm
Whichever company you go for it is important to chat with a couple to get a feel for them and find a company which you are comfortable with -- you are going into a fairly intimate financial relationship.

HB have had mixed mentions of late ( but all firms have their ups and downs). Have a look around the forum to see what experiences we have had with various firms.
